Welcome to the online community for people interested in the daguerreotype, the first publicly announced process of photography. Originally two websites- ContemporaryDaguerreotypes.info and DagForum.com, set up independently and almost simultaneously, these have now combined to promote a single online daguerreian community.

All users can register to participate in the online community via the Forum, contemporary daguerreotypists who wish to display images of their work in the galleries section can have their own gallery page with biographical details and links to their own websites.

Through the Resources section and the Wiki we hope to build a comprehensive resource for all things daguerriean that will foster the advancement of daguerreian artists and the daguerreotype process.
